Phillip Steven “Steve” Sellers JEFFERSONVILLE - Phillip Steven “Steve” Sellers, 68, of Hamlin Floyd Rd., passed away Friday August 20, 2021 in Dublin. Services will be held Tuesday August 31, 2021 at 11:00AM at Mount Zion Baptist Church, in Danville, GA. Burial will be in the Georgia Veterans Memorial Cemetery in Milledgeville, GA. Rev. Dwayne Bedingfield will officiate. Mr. Sellers was born in Moultrie, GA, the son of the late Paul Augustus Sellars and Bobbye Jean Paulk Sellars, and was preceded in death by his great grandson, Hope Lui. Steve grew up in Moultrie, GA, attending Moultrie Elementary School, Dougherty Jr High, Dougherty High School, and Crandall Business College. He was a Veteran of the United States Air Force serving during Vietnam War. He was a former employee of the City of Warner Robins Water Treatment Dept. Steve was a POST certified Peace Officer and was the former Chief of Police of Baconton, GA, and was retired after 33 years from Marine Corps Logistic Base Albany, where he received many awards and certificates associated with his job in Water/Wastewater Operations. He was a member of Mount Zion Baptist Church. Steve’s love of music and singing allowed him to minister in music to nursing homes, assisted living facilities, churches, and civic groups in whatever community he lived in.
